Key terms

  • Personal Rule: The period from 1629 to 1640 when Charles I ruled without calling Parliament.
  • Royal Prerogative: The powers exercised by the monarch without the consent of Parliament.

Common trap

Confusing Personal Rule with the Long Parliament: Focus on the specific timeframe and policies of Personal Rule (1629-1640) and distinguish them from the events that occurred after Parliament was recalled in 1640.
